A quick question regarding R25,26,34,35 resistors which as per the build and BOM it says 221R 1/2W and I have some spare 221R rated @ 1/8W. The same with the R33 can I use 22K 1/2W instead of 22.1K?

Regarding the diodes can I use the "MUR160 DIODE, ULTRA-FAST, 1A, 600V" instead of the regular 1N4004?

R33 is only for Led light so yes you can use 22K is tiny difference.
221R you use always the same BOM wattage or more example 3/4 watts or 1 watts but not 1/8.
Diodes ? Yes MUR160 are OK :)
